The number 10,000 did not originate in a research lab or a cardiology clinic.

It was created in Tokyo in 1965 to sell a pedometer named Manpo-kei, which translates literally to '10,000-steps meter.' The company chose the number because the Japanese character for 10,000 looks vaguely like a walking person. It was a brilliant marketing hook, but it was completely arbitrary.

Fitness app developers simply copied that 1965 marketing target into modern algorithms because it sounded neat and challenging.

Biological aging changes how your vascular walls respond to stress and how your cartilage handles repetitive force. Expecting a 68-year-old knee to thrive on the same volume as a 22-year-old marathon runner ignores basic biomechanics. What your physiology actually requires for cardiovascular protection and joint longevity is a far more reasonable figure.

What Happens Inside an Aging Body at 4,000 Steps

What Happens Inside an Aging Body at 4,000 Steps

Your legs act as an auxiliary heart.

When you walk, the deep muscles in your calves contract against non-yielding fascia, squeezing the deep veins inside your lower leg. This calf-muscle pump propels blood upward against gravity, driving venous return to your heart and preventing fluid pool buildup around your ankles. At 4,000 steps, this mechanical pump has cycled thousands of times, dramatically easing arterial workload.

Inside your bloodstream, moderate movement activates a critical metabolic pathway.

Physical contraction of skeletal muscle signals GLUT4 glucose transporters to migrate to the surface of your muscle cells. These transporters clear sugar directly from your blood without demanding heavy insulin production from an aging pancreas. Meanwhile, your knee cartilage—which has no direct blood supply—relies on the rhythm of impact to sponge up nourishing synovial fluid.

The steep drop in mortality risk occurs between 3,000 and 7,000 steps. Beyond that, the curve flattens significantly for older adults.

The Baseline Shift: Where the Steepest Risk Drop Happens

The Baseline Shift: Where the Steepest Risk Drop Happens

The relationship between movement and longevity is not a straight line.

Major meta-analyses published in major public health journals tracked over 47,000 adults across four continents to map step counts against mortality. The findings were undeniable: the most dramatic reduction in early death risk occurs when moving from a sedentary baseline of 2,000 steps up to roughly 4,500 steps per day.

This is the law of diminishing marginal returns in biological action.

Going from 2,000 steps to 4,000 steps cuts your cardiovascular risk significantly more than going from 7,000 steps to 9,000 steps. That initial bracket of movement restores vascular elasticity, clears post-meal glucose spikes, and calms systemic inflammation. If you only reach 4,500 steps on a busy day, you have already secured the vast majority of the biological benefit.

The Longevity Plateau: Finding Your Personal Ceiling

The Longevity Plateau: Finding Your Personal Ceiling

More is not always better when joint restoration is the priority.

For adults aged 60 and older, mortality benefits reach a clear plateau between 6,000 and 8,000 steps per day. While younger adults under 60 continue seeing slight risk decreases up to 10,000 steps, older physiology hits its maximum protective efficiency much sooner.

Cadence matters, but total daily volume remains the primary engine.

Walking at a brisk pace of roughly 100 steps per minute stimulates mitochondrial biogenesis in your thigh muscles, enhancing energy output. However, if joint discomfort forces you to walk slower, do not worry. Accumulating 6,000 steps at a relaxed pace still preserves spatial gait variability, executive cognitive function, and the balance recovery mechanisms that protect you from falls.

The Non-Negotiable Factor: Consistency Over Heroic Distance

The Non-Negotiable Factor: Consistency Over Heroic Distance

A single massive weekend trek cannot compensate for five days on the couch.

Physical therapists and geriatric researchers emphasize that 4,500 steps taken six days a week provides vastly superior vascular protection compared to hitting 12,000 steps on Sunday and remaining sedentary all week. Uninterrupted sitting for more than eight hours blunts arterial elasticity and reverses the positive endothelial gains of exercise.

Chunking your movement is just as effective as one long haul.

You do not need to block out an hour of continuous walking. Breaking your day into three 10-minute movement bouts—after breakfast, after lunch, and after dinner—delivers identical blood pressure reduction while placing far less continuous impact load on your hip and knee cartilage.

The Self-Check: How to Set Your Daily Target Without Injury

The Self-Check: How to Set Your Daily Target Without Injury

Never increase your step count based on what a friend or an article recommends.

Start with a 3-day baseline audit. Wear a simple pedometer or keep your phone in your pocket for three normal days without changing your routine, then average those numbers. That average is your true biological starting point.

Follow the 10 percent progression rule.

If your baseline is 3,200 steps, do not jump to 6,000 tomorrow. Add no more than 400 steps per day each week. This slow ramp allows your plantar fascia, Achilles tendons, and knee cartilage to adapt to mechanical load without triggering inflammatory flare-ups.
